win10安装linux子系统

× 文章目录
  1. 1. 0x00 描述
  2. 2. 0x01 启用linux子系统
  3. 3. 0x02 安装linux子系统
  4. 4. 0x03 win10安装linux子系统报错0x8007019e解决办法
  • 1.备份原来的数据源配置文件
  • 2.编辑数据源配置文件
  • lsb_release -a
    1. 0.1. 读取宿主机文件
  • 0x00 描述

    win10系统一周年正式版(1607)之后开始支持内置linux子系统,记录一些关键步骤和遇到的问题

    0x01 启用linux子系统

    启用1

    启用2

    0x02 安装linux子系统

    打开win10应用商店,搜索linux,选择ubuntu安装

    安装

    0x03 win10安装linux子系统报错0x8007019e解决办法

    原因: 未安装Windows子系统支持

    1. win+x,选择Windows PowerShell(管理员)
    2. 输入
      -Online -FeatureName Microsoft-Windows-Subsystem-Linux```
      1
      2
      3
      4
      5
      3. 回车,输入Y,重启系统后重新打开安装的对应子系统即可

      ## 0x04 开始使用

      ### 换源

    1.备份原来的数据源配置文件

    cp /etc/apt/sources.list /etc/apt/sources.list_backup

    2.编辑数据源配置文件

    vi /etc/apt/sources.list

    1
    2

    使用[中科大的源]("http://mirrors.ustc.edu.cn/help/ubuntu.html#id1")

    lsb_release -a

    No LSB modules are available.
    Distributor ID: Ubuntu
    Description: Ubuntu 18.04.1 LTS
    Release: 18.04
    Codename: bionic

    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    ```
    deb https://mirrors.ustc.edu.cn/ubuntu/ bionic main restricted universe multiverse
    deb-src https://mirrors.ustc.edu.cn/ubuntu/ bionic main restricted universe multiverse

    deb https://mirrors.ustc.edu.cn/ubuntu/ bionic-security main restricted universe multiverse
    deb-src https://mirrors.ustc.edu.cn/ubuntu/ bionic-security main restricted universe multiverse

    deb https://mirrors.ustc.edu.cn/ubuntu/ bionic-updates main restricted universe multiverse
    deb-src https://mirrors.ustc.edu.cn/ubuntu/ bionic-updates main restricted universe multiverse

    deb https://mirrors.ustc.edu.cn/ubuntu/ bionic-backports main restricted universe multiverse
    deb-src https://mirrors.ustc.edu.cn/ubuntu/ bionic-backports main restricted universe multiverse

    读取宿主机文件

    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    # df -h
    Filesystem Size Used Avail Use% Mounted on
    rootfs 101G 62G 39G 62% /
    none 101G 62G 39G 62% /dev
    none 101G 62G 39G 62% /run
    none 101G 62G 39G 62% /run/lock
    none 101G 62G 39G 62% /run/shm
    none 101G 62G 39G 62% /run/user
    C: 101G 62G 39G 62% /mnt/c
    D: 279G 54G 225G 20% /mnt/d
    E: 278G 38G 240G 14% /mnt/e
    F: 277G 191G 87G 69% /mnt/f